Output 32633147473196f33c5a2b7de4b75308a80e85351b0df001ed564e04361f5088:3

value
67238388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59e58e7d3e9ebc81af5c04cc8e0ead666a14a675 OP_EQUAL
address
MG6VNNiNiYoyyQjD8ynH91TEmJnXPhp7PE
transaction
32633147473196f33c5a2b7de4b75308a80e85351b0df001ed564e04361f5088
spent
true